mvn test 编译并测试 mvn package 生成target目录,编译、测试代码,生成测试报错,生成jar/war文件 mvn site生成项目相关信息的网站 mvn clean compile 表示先运行清理之后进行编译,会将代码编译到target文件夹中 mvn clean package 运行清理和打包 mvn clean install运行清理和安装,会将打好的包安装到本地仓库中,以便...
mvn package 生成target目录,编译、测试代码,生成测试报告,生成jar/war文件 mvn site 生成项目相关信息的网站 mvn clean compile 表示先运行清理之后运行编译,会将代码编译到target文件夹中 mvn clean package 运行清理和打包 mvn clean install 运行清理和安装,会将打好的包安装到本地仓库中,以便其他的项目可以调用 ...
如果你想定义一个 jar 或者 Package 在所有子项目都使用的话,你需要使用 dependencies 来进行定义。这样所有你在 dependencies 中定义的 Package 将会自动被导入到子项目中。 dependencyManagement只是声明依赖,并不实际导入 Package。所以在 dependencyManagement 中声明的 Package 还必须在子项目中再声明一次。 https://w...
区别和使用 如果你想定义一个 jar 或者 Package 在所有子项目都使用的话,你需要使用 dependencies 来进行定义。这样所有你在 dependencies 中定义的 Package 将会自动被导入到子项目中。dependencyManagement只是声明依赖,并不实际导入 Package。所以在 dependencyManagement 中声明的 Package 还必须在子项目中再声明一次。
区别和使用 如果你想定义一个 jar 或者 Package 在所有子项目都使用的话,你需要使用 dependencies 来进行定义。这样所有你在 dependencies 中定义的 Package 将会自动被导入到子项目中。 dependencyManagement只是声明依赖,并不实际导入 Package。所以在 dependencyManagement 中声明的 Package 还必须在子项目中再声明一次。
--main主类的全类名-->main.Class</manifest></archive><descriptorRefs><descriptorRef>jar-with-dependencies</descriptorRef></descriptorRefs></configuration><executions><execution><id>make-assembly</id><!--指定在打包节点执行jar包合并操作, 使用package就可以打出全量包--><phase>package</phase><goals...
<phase>package</phase> <goals> <goal>single</goal> </goals> <configuration> <archive> <manifest> vip.meet.start.Main </manifest> </archive> <descriptorRefs> <descriptorRef>jar-with-dependencies</descriptorRef> </descriptorRefs> </configuration...
-- 方法一:package装入依赖的jar包到libs目录 --><plugin><groupId>org.apache.maven.plugins</groupId><artifactId>maven-dependency-plugin</artifactId><executions><execution><id>copy-dependencies</id><phase>prepare-package</phase><goals><goal>copy-dependencies</goal></goals><configuration>${project...
-- 其他依赖 --> </dependencies> 将依赖的作用域设置为 provided 后,当 Maven 构建 WAR 或 JAR ...
I'd like Maven to package a project alongside its run-time dependencies. I expect it to create a JAR file with the following manifest: ... Main-Class : com.acme.MainClass Class-Path : lib/dependency1.jar lib/dependency2.jar ... and create the following directory structure: target |...